T104xD4RDB: Fix PHY address for PHY connected to FM1@DTSEC3
authorCodrin Ciubotariu <codrin.ciubotariu@freescale.com>
Mon, 12 Oct 2015 13:33:13 +0000 (16:33 +0300)
committerYork Sun <yorksun@freescale.com>
Mon, 2 Nov 2015 16:51:10 +0000 (08:51 -0800)
On T1040D4RDB board, u-boot fails to connect port FM1@DTSEC3 to
the Ethernet PHY because the wrong PHY address is used. Also,
T1040D4RDB supports SGMII on one port only.

Signed-off-by: Codrin Ciubotariu <codrin.ciubotariu@freescale.com>
Reviewed-by: York Sun <yorksun@freescale.com>
include/configs/T104xRDB.h

index da2ccb831838deac3962a6915d47d379793a02c2..840be047cd96b7980b85396104a387f79f7c1aa1 100644 (file)
@@ -741,7 +741,9 @@ $(SRCTREE)/board/freescale/t104xrdb/t1042d4_rcw.cfg
 #ifdef CONFIG_FMAN_ENET
 #if defined(CONFIG_T1040RDB) || defined(CONFIG_T1042RDB)
 #define CONFIG_SYS_SGMII1_PHY_ADDR             0x03
-#elif defined(CONFIG_T1040D4RDB) || defined(CONFIG_T1042D4RDB)
+#elif defined(CONFIG_T1040D4RDB)
+#define CONFIG_SYS_SGMII1_PHY_ADDR             0x01
+#elif defined(CONFIG_T1042D4RDB)
 #define CONFIG_SYS_SGMII1_PHY_ADDR             0x02
 #define CONFIG_SYS_SGMII2_PHY_ADDR             0x03
 #define CONFIG_SYS_SGMII3_PHY_ADDR             0x01